Building a Strong Ethical Framework

Ethics in business is critical for sustaining success. The Charles Stanley devotional encourages individuals to prioritize integrity and transparency. Here’s how you can apply these principles:

  • Set Clear Values: Define the core values of your business and communicate them effectively with your team.
  • Lead by Example: Demonstrate ethical behavior in all business dealings to inspire trust and responsibility within your organization.
  • Encourage Open Communication: Foster an environment where employees feel comfortable discussing ethical concerns without fear of retribution.

The Importance of Effective Leadership

Successful businesses often reflect strong leadership. The principles found in the Charles Stanley devotional emphasize that true leaders inspire and uplift those around them. Here are some leadership qualities to embody:

Servant Leadership

The essence of servant leadership is putting the needs of others first. This approach not only fosters loyalty but enhances team performance. Here’s how to practice servant leadership:

  • Listen Actively: Give your team the opportunity to share their thoughts and concerns.
  • Provide Support: Equip your employees with the tools and resources they need to succeed.
  • Celebrate Achievements: Recognize both individual and team accomplishments to boost morale.
